What is Darwin's theory of the origin of species?

Respuesta :

4617685
4617685 4617685
  • 03-12-2020

Answer:

The theory of evolution by natural selection, first formulated in Darwin's book "On the Origin of Species" in 1859, is the process by which organisms change over time as a result of changes in heritable physical or behavioral traits.
